green fusion sauce

I love foods that are reminiscent of Thai cooking, without the excess heat. This would work on a chicken breast sandwich or as a veggie dip. Thin it a bit to use as a salad dressing or marinade.

Ingredients
- 1 medium avocado, pitted and peeled
- 1/2 cup cilantro, packed
- 1/2 cup parsley, packed
- 1 medium jalapeno, seeds and ribs removed, chopped
- 2 cloves garlic
- 2 - limes, juice of and zest of one
- 1/2 cup water
- 1/3 cup olive oil
- 1 teaspoon salt (or to taste)
- 1/2 cup blanched almond slivers (or pistachios)
- - salt and pepper to taste
How To Make green fusion sauce
-
Step 1In bowl of a food processor, add all ingredients up to nuts. Pulse.
-
Step 2Add nuts, pulse until almost smooth. Taste - add additional salt and pepper if needed.
-
Step 3Serve as a dip or on sandwiches. Thin with vinegar, water or oil to use as a salad dressing or marinade.
